Dump-and-Bake Chicken Tzatziki with Rice

This Dump-and-Bake Chicken Tzatziki with Rice is a simple, one-pan Mediterranean-style dish where everything bakes together—juicy chicken, fluffy rice, garlic, lemon, and herbs—finished with a cool, creamy tzatziki sauce.
It’s fresh, healthy, and comforting at the same time. No complicated steps. No pre-cooking rice. Just mix, bake, and serve.
Ingredients
Chicken & Rice Base:
- 500g chicken breast or thighs (cut into chunks)
- 1 1/2 cups long grain rice (uncooked)
- 3 cups chicken broth
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 3 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 tsp dried oregano
- 1 tsp paprika
- 1 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- Juice of 1 lemon
Tzatziki Sauce:
- 1 cup Greek yogurt
- 1/2 cucumber (grated and drained)
- 1–2 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 tbsp lemon juice
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- Salt to taste
- Fresh dill or parsley (optional)
Optional Add-ons:
- Cherry tomatoes
- Sliced olives
- Feta cheese
- Fresh parsley
Substitutions:
- Chicken → turkey or tofu
- Greek yogurt → regular yogurt (thicker strained preferred)
- Rice → quinoa or couscous (adjust liquid)
- Olive oil → avocado oil
Timing
- Preparation time: 10–15 minutes
- Baking time: 45–55 minutes
- Total time: about 1 hour 10 minutes
This is much faster in hands-on effort compared to stovetop rice and pan-cooked chicken meals.
Instructions
Step 1: Preheat oven
Preheat oven to 190°C (375°F).
Tip: A fully heated oven ensures even rice cooking.
Step 2: Assemble the dish
In a large baking dish, add uncooked rice, chicken pieces, garlic, oregano, paprika, salt, pepper, olive oil, lemon juice, and chicken broth.
Stir everything together.
Tip: Make sure rice is fully submerged in liquid for proper cooking.
Step 3: Bake covered
Cover tightly with foil and bake for 40–45 minutes.
Tip: The steam is what cooks the rice—don’t skip the cover.
Step 4: Check doneness
Remove foil and check if rice is tender and chicken is fully cooked.
If needed, bake uncovered for 5–10 more minutes.
Step 5: Make tzatziki
Mix Greek yogurt, grated cucumber, garlic, lemon juice, olive oil, salt, and herbs in a bowl.
Tip: Squeeze cucumber well to avoid watery sauce.
Step 6: Serve
Fluff rice, plate the chicken, and top with tzatziki sauce.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Not covering tightly (rice stays undercooked)
- Using too little liquid
- Cutting chicken too large (uneven cooking)
- Skipping cucumber draining (watery tzatziki)
- Overbaking (dry chicken)
Storage Tips
- Store in fridge for up to 4 days
- Keep tzatziki separate for freshness
- Reheat rice with a splash of water or broth
- Do not freeze tzatziki (texture changes)
- Freeze rice and chicken separately if needed
